The KODAK SLIDE N SCAN Film and Slide Scanner is designed to save your old photo memories by converting various types of film negatives and slides into high-resolution digital photos. One of its standout features is the 22MP resolution, which ensures that your converted images are crisp and detailed. The scanner also includes a large 5” LCD screen, allowing you to preview and edit photos directly on the device, making it user-friendly and convenient for everyday use.
The easy-load film inserts and continuous loading action simplify the scanning process, which is a significant advantage for users looking to digitize large collections of film quickly. Additionally, the device supports SD and SDHC cards up to 32GB, providing ample storage for your scanned images. The USB and HDMI connectivity options make it versatile and compatible with most modern computers and displays.
The one-touch editing feature is designed to enhance, resize, and convert photos without the need for complex software, making it accessible to users who may not be tech-savvy. Some drawbacks include the SD card not being included, which means you will need to purchase one separately. While the scanner's resolution is impressive, its color depth is not specified, which might be an important consideration for users emphasizing color accuracy in their scans. The product is lightweight and compact, blending easily with home décor, but it may feel less sturdy compared to more robust models. The KODAK SLIDE N SCAN is a solid choice for those looking to preserve their old photos with ease and quality, especially for users who appreciate straightforward operation and good connectivity.
The KODAK REELS 8mm & Super 8 Films Digitizer Converter is a versatile tool designed for converting old film reels into digital MP4 files, making it an excellent option for preserving vintage memories. One of its standout features is the frame-by-frame digitizing process with an 8.08-megapixel sensor, which ensures high-definition 1080p video quality. This makes the resulting videos clear and detailed, although it should be noted that the converter does not capture sound from the original films.
The large 5-inch LCD screen with touch buttons allows for easy navigation and real-time playback, which is a significant plus for users who prefer a hands-on approach without needing external editing equipment. Its compact and portable design makes it convenient for travel and storage, and the included accessories facilitate a smooth setup process. However, the resolution of 240 may be seen as low by modern standards, which could impact the quality of converted films.
Connectivity is handled via USB, which is standard but may limit speed for some users. The device operates independently of a computer, which simplifies usage, but it might lack some advanced software features for those who are looking for more detailed editing options. Compatibility with Windows 7 or later ensures broad usability, though the need for an SD card (not included) for storage could be a minor inconvenience. This converter is best suited for film enthusiasts or families looking to digitize and share their old 8mm and Super 8 films in a straightforward and user-friendly way.
The KODAK 7" Digital Film Scanner is designed for those looking to preserve their old photo memories by converting 35mm, 126, and 110 negatives and slides into 22MP JPEG digital files. One of its standout features is the high resolution of 3200 DPI, which ensures detailed and sharp images. The large 7” LCD display is another highlight, offering a clear and convenient way to preview and edit photos directly on the device without needing a computer. This makes it user-friendly, especially for those who are not tech-savvy.
The scanner supports SD and SDHC cards up to 32GB, although it's worth noting that the SD card is not included in the package. Connectivity is catered for with USB Type-C, allowing for easy transfer of scanned images to a computer. However, an HDMI cable is not included for those who might want to connect the device to a larger screen. The included advanced capture software simplifies the editing process with a single-touch button, allowing easy adjustments of color, brightness, and date/time settings. This is beneficial for users who want to enhance their scanned images without dealing with complex software.
While the quick-feeding tray technology makes the scanning process fast, some users might find the lack of an automatic feeder inconvenient if they have a large volume of slides or negatives to scan. The scanner’s lightweight and compact design make it highly portable and easy to store, blending seamlessly with home décor. Despite its strengths, the product has some limitations, such as the need for a separate SD card purchase and the absence of an HDMI cable. This scanner is best suited for casual users looking to digitize and edit their old photo collections without needing extensive technical knowledge.
